PREVARICATOR

 Dictionary entry overview: What does prevaricator mean? 

PREVARICATOR (noun)
  The noun PREVARICATOR has 1 sense:

1. a person who has lied or who lies repeatedly

  Familiarity information: PREVARICATOR used as a noun is very rare.


 Dictionary entry details 


PREVARICATOR (noun)


Sense 1prevaricator [BACK TO TOP]

Meaning:

A person who has lied or who lies repeatedly

Classified under:

Nouns denoting people

Synonyms:

liar; prevaricator

Hypernyms ("prevaricator" is a kind of...):

beguiler; cheat; cheater; deceiver; slicker; trickster (someone who leads you to believe something that is not true)

Hyponyms (each of the following is a kind of "prevaricator"):

false witness; perjurer (a person who deliberately gives false testimony)

fabricator; fibber; storyteller (someone who tells lies)

Instance hyponyms:

Ananias (a habitual liar (after a New Testament character who was struck dead for lying))
